CAS 439692-05-4
:ethyl 4-cyclopropylthiazole-2-carboxylate
Description:
Ethyl 4-cyclopropylthiazole-2-carboxylate is a chemical compound characterized by its unique thiazole ring structure, which incorporates a cyclopropyl group and an ethyl ester functional group. This compound typically exhibits properties common to thiazoles, such as being a heterocyclic aromatic compound, which may contribute to its biological activity. The presence of the cyclopropyl group can influence the compound's steric and electronic properties, potentially affecting its reactivity and interactions with biological targets. Ethyl 4-cyclopropylthiazole-2-carboxylate may be of interest in medicinal chemistry and drug development due to its structural features, which could impart specific pharmacological properties. Additionally, the compound's solubility, stability, and reactivity can vary based on environmental conditions and the presence of other functional groups. As with many organic compounds, safety and handling precautions should be observed, particularly in laboratory settings, to mitigate any potential hazards associated with its use.
Formula:C9H11NO2S
InChI:InChI=1/C9H11NO2S/c1-2-12-9(11)8-10-7(5-13-8)6-3-4-6/h5-6H,2-4H2,1H3
SMILES:CCOC(=O)c1nc(cs1)C1CC1
Synonyms:- 2-Thiazolecarboxylic acid, 4-cyclopropyl-, ethyl ester
- Ethyl 4-cyclopropyl-1,3-thiazole-2-carboxylate
